Western Europe experienced its hottest June on record last month, highlighting the growing impact of climate change as prolonged heatwaves swept across the region. According to the European Union’s Copernicus Climate Change Service, average temperatures reached unprecedented levels, breaking the previous June record and raising fresh concerns about extreme weather events.
Data released by the climate monitoring agency showed that Western Europe recorded an average temperature of 20.74°C during June, more than 3°C above the 1991–2020 climate average. The figure surpassed the previous June record, which had been set in 2025, making this the warmest June ever observed in the region.
The record-breaking temperatures were driven by multiple heatwaves that affected several European countries throughout the month. Many areas experienced prolonged periods of extreme heat, leading authorities to issue health advisories, wildfire warnings, and emergency measures to protect vulnerable populations.
Scientists say the increasing frequency and intensity of heatwaves are consistent with long-term global warming trends. Rising greenhouse gas emissions have contributed to higher global temperatures, making extreme weather events more likely and more severe across many parts of the world.
The latest findings from the Copernicus Climate Change Service add to a growing body of evidence showing that Europe is warming faster than many other regions. Higher temperatures not only increase health risks but also place additional pressure on water supplies, agriculture, energy systems, and ecosystems.
Experts warn that prolonged heat can have significant economic and environmental consequences. Reduced crop yields, increased electricity demand for cooling, transportation disruptions, and a higher risk of wildfires are among the challenges associated with recurring heatwaves.
Governments across Europe have been strengthening climate adaptation strategies, including heat action plans, improved emergency response systems, and investments in resilient infrastructure. At the same time, policymakers continue to emphasize the importance of reducing greenhouse gas emissions to limit the long-term effects of climate change.
The record-setting June serves as another reminder of the changing global climate and the need for coordinated action to address rising temperatures. As extreme weather becomes more frequent, scientists stress that both mitigation and adaptation measures will be essential to protect communities, economies, and natural ecosystems in the years ahead.
